What is Stump Grinding?
Stump grinding is a professional service that involves using specialized equipment to grind down tree stumps into small wood chips. Unlike stump removal, which can involve digging up the entire root system, stump grinding only addresses the visible part of the stump. This method is less invasive and leaves a lot less mess, making it an excellent choice for homeowners who want to maintain a neat yard.
The Stump Grinding Process
Understanding the stump grinding process can help you see why it's a preferred option for removing stumps. Here's what you can expect:
Inspection and Assessment
Before grinding begins, a professional will inspect the stump to determine the size and condition. This helps them choose the appropriate equipment and assess any potential challenges, like nearby structures or underground utilities.
Grinding the Stump
Using a specialized stump grinder, the technician will grind the stump into small chips. The grinder’s rotating blades shred the stump into fine wood particles, typically up to several inches below the soil’s surface.
Disposal of Debris
After the grinding process, the wood chips and debris will be cleaned up. Depending on your preferences, the debris can either be left in your yard as mulch or hauled away.
Filling the Hole
Once the stump is ground down, you may be left with a hole in your yard. Some homeowners choose to fill this hole with soil and plant grass or other vegetation, while others use it for landscaping features.
Benefits of Stump Grinding
Stump grinding offers numerous advantages over other stump removal methods. Here are just a few reasons why you should consider this service:
Cost-Effective
Compared to stump removal, stump grinding is often more affordable. Stump removal requires digging up the entire root system, which can take longer and involve heavy machinery. Stump grinding is faster, easier, and typically costs less.
Faster Process
Stump grinding is quicker than other removal methods. The process can usually be completed within a few hours, depending on the size of the stump, while stump removal may take an entire day or more.
Less Lawn Damage
Since stump grinding only targets the stump and doesn’t involve digging, it results in minimal disruption to the surrounding lawn. This means less repair work is required to restore your yard to its original state.
Pest Control
Tree stumps can attract insects like termites, ants, and beetles, which can damage your property. Grinding the stump removes this potential habitat, reducing the risk of infestations.
Aesthetic Appeal
Stumps can be an eyesore in your yard, interfering with the beauty of your landscape. Grinding the stump away restores your yard’s visual appeal and makes it easier to mow and maintain.
Prevents New Growth
Some tree species can send out new shoots from the stump. Stump grinding eliminates the root system’s energy reserves, preventing the regrowth of these unwanted shoots and ensuring your lawn stays free of new growth.
Stump Grinding vs. Stump Removal: What’s the Difference?
While both stump grinding and stump removal aim to get rid of tree stumps, the two methods differ in several key ways:
-
Stump Grinding: Only the visible portion of the stump is ground down, leaving the roots behind. This process is quicker and involves less disruption to the surrounding area.
-
Stump Removal: The entire stump, including the root system, is dug out and removed. This method is more invasive and can cause more damage to the surrounding lawn.
Stump grinding is typically the preferred choice for most homeowners because it’s quicker, more affordable, and less disruptive.
